Quote Icon This course is ideal for:

Do you want to get off to a flying start with learning Spanish? Maybe you have been using Duolingo but want to brush up on the basics before you go on holiday? This course is for you!

This is an intensive all-day course. We will look at important words and phrases used to talk about ourselves, for when we don’t understand something and for shopping.

Following the class, you will have one year’s access to the virtual learning environment with loads of content to help you revise what we cover on the day and to finish off the workbook.

Our classes are relaxed and friendly as we focus on communication, not perfection. Lunch and teas and coffees are provided on the day.

The course will run 10am – 5pm on Saturday 13th July 2024 and there are only 8 places available.

Please pay a deposit of £50 to reserve your place. I kindly ask that full fees are paid before the day of the course.

About

I am passionate about languages and studied French and Spanish at Cambridge University. I am now a qualified Modern Foreign Languages teacher at secondary level and have experience of teaching primary level languages all the way up to A level.

I love visiting new places and have spent time travelling around and volunteering in South America. Whenever I go to a new place I always try to have a go at the local language and can often be found clutching my phrase book with a look of polite terror as the person I am talking to replies to my question at top speed! As a result I am able to empathise with learners who feel nervous about speaking in front of others or who have had similar experiences with languages on holiday.

Whether you are starting from scratch, dusting off your high school French and Spanish or perfecting your language skills, Language for Fun classes provide a supportive and relaxed environment to learn and have fun. I hope you will join us!
